I'm not good at question time, especially in a group of strangers. One question I wanted to ask was if you are a good illustrator (like a friend of mine) but not a good storyteller can you still get a job with TokyoPop? Or do they only hire people who can illustrate their own stories?
Hey thanks, and I was wondering whether I was boring the crap out of everyone too. :-) The lecture was fun, I had a good time talking. Thanks to everyone who was there!
As for your question, you CAN still get a job with TOKYOPOP if you're a good illustrator. Mostly this is restricted to inking and toning, though if you're a penciller you're expected to panel the pages so it may be a problem if you're not a great storyteller. I suggest you look on TOKYOPOP's site to see whether they have job openings for people who ONLY ink or tone.
Ofcourse, if you can illustrate your own story, it'll be fantastic, but it's rarer than you'll think. :-) If you're a writer, you can probably get them to find an artist for you if your story is compelling enough.
1 more question, if you don't mind. Now Manga's are sticking with tradition with reading right to left, when panelling, do employers prefer a right to left read or left to right read or doesn't it matter.
If you're drawing in English, then it should read from left-to-right.
The publisher should specify that. If not, go from left-to-right.

WOAH?! I don't know anything about Capcom publishing Chaos Code - I thought it was Arc Systems? Arc Systems is the company that publishes Guilty Gear - I last worked at FKDigital in mid-April, and I haven't heard of any change of publisher. I was told that the game is in development for Japan only, and from the story development guys (all 100% Japanese Otaku), they made great pains to tailor the story to the Japanese market.
But in terms of the development of the game, no, I don't work there anymore, but the game graphics are ALL DONE (which is why I don't work there anymore). The bulk of the original work consists of the graphics anyway, because the game system itself already exists, and all there is to do is to slot in the characters and the stats, etc. They should be doing the testing and remaining programming work right now.
That said, the game graphics are banned from the Internet until the trailer is shown at the Tokyo Game Convention. That's what they told me when I was working there.
